In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

wifi: mac80211: don’t WARN for connections on invalid channels

It’s not clear (to me) how exactly syzbot managed to hit this, but it seems conceivable that e.g. regulatory changed and has disabled a channel between scanning (channel is checked to be usable by cfg80211_get_ies_channel_number) and connecting on the channel later.

With one scenario that isn’t covered elsewhere described above, the warning isn’t good, replace it with a (more informative) error message.
